A german shepherd doesn't have full bladder control until about 5 to 6 months of age so plan on continuing your potty training efforts until they have control of their elimination habits. Crate training utilizes your puppy's instinct to stay clear of dirtying, where it rests as part of the training process, consequently making it simple for the puppy to comprehend and quickly learn.
